Modavie est un lieu intemporel qui nous rappelle nos racines, où dames & messieurs se réunissent pour manger dans une atmosphère animée causée par de bonnes conversations, de la musique live et les parfums boisés d’une salle vintage. Né en 1997, il est rapidement devenu populaire parmi les locaux et les visiteurs, et est maintenant considéré comme une institution montréalaise.
Régalez-vous avec une cuisine française raffinée dans un espace antique et tamisé sur deux étages. Du classique tartare de bœuf, au savoureux ris de veau, en passant par la fameuse ratatouille, vos envies seront facilement rassasiées.

The vibes here were amazing, super elegant yet homey & cozy. Everyday they have an accompaniment for music & the day we went had jazz playing while we were eating. The apps (escargot & soup) were 🤌- both were not your standard snails or french onion soup. The soup had an extremely rich flavour shine through that came from the deep caramelization of the onions. The accompanying garlic butter & cheese that was paired with the escargot was salty which was good. Onto the mains, the table favourite was the duck confit. The duck was so tender & when paired with the sweetness of the walnuts & the acid from the pickled cabbage, it made a wonderful bite. The lamb chops were great as well, the meat was cooked to our liking. We do wish there was a sauce to accompany the lamb, perhaps a sweet red wine sauce to cut through the saltiness of the veggies & enhance the lamb taste. As an aside, the potatoes were delicious LOL. The lamb pasta was amazing as well, flavour-wise. We wish there would have been more lamb in the pasta as the portion of meat felt lacklustre. The pasta was perfectly cooked & held onto the sauce very well. Lastly, the drinks were delicious- perfectly balanced between sweet & tangy. The service here was phenomenal, they consistently checked up on us & made sure we were well taken care of. Overall, the restaurant was a great experience in MTL, a good place to go to if you're in the area & are looking for a more expensive dinner.Voir plus
